Trade : South countries voice concern over EU's deforestation-free regulatio n (PRIV)
(D. Ravi Kanth, Geneva)
Several developing countries have raised a "red flag" against the European Union's regulation on deforestation-free pr oducts (EUDR), which was announced on 29 June 2023, saying that it "disregards loc al circumstances and capabilities, national legislation and certification mech anisms of developing producer countries, their efforts to fight deforestation and multilateral commitments, including the principle of common but differentia ted responsibilities."

Africa : Agro-processors call for policies conducive to local manufacturing (PRIV)
(IPS, Dar es Salaam)
Experts at the Africa Food Sy stems Forum (AGRF) in Dar es Salaam, Tanzania, have called on African governments to make and review existing policies to protect the processing and agro-industrialisation of locally produced agricultural products.
